In 2023,  the majority of couples are taking inspiration and going for unique and creative table decoration ideas for the wedding day. One large trend is to  employ natural materials. That  includes flowers, leaves and even fruit on the tables. For instance, a mason jar filled with wildflowers can offer natural country charm. Some couples are even opting for potted plants to double as centerpieces that guests can take home. Another trend is blending styles. That would be mixing modern and old. You may see  fancy gold plates beside rustic wood table runners. As a mix, this is a fun, interesting look.  Another well-liked suggestion  would be to use bight colors. Now brides and grooms are skipping white and cream and going for bold colors — deep blue or rich burgundy, a flash of bright yellow.  These hues can easily be utilized  in napkins, tablecloths and centerpieces. You can also personalize the decor even more with your own  name cards, or themes that mesh well with the couple’s hobbies or interests. For instance, the couple might be passionate about travel and so there could be various decorations such as a globe or maps on  the tables. Finally, lighting is really important.  A lot of weddings use the fairy  lights or candles on tables now to give it a warm feel. This kind of  soft  lighting just feels cozy  and romantic. So, whether you like a classic feel or  something more au  courant, ideas about table decorations are myriad for  2023.

It can be hard to find a wedding table decorations  idea that isn’t either to expensive or too complicated. But there are plenty of other places to find cheaper alternatives. On a positive note, a great idea would be to visit wholesale stores. These types of stores sometimes sell decor in bulk, so you can get a lot for not  much money. There are  websites such as  Martina for all sorts of decorations, from tablecloths to centerpieces. You can also pay a visit to your local craft and decoration shops. Many of these stores have sales, particularly around wedding seasons, and you can find one-of-a-kind items  to make your tables pop. You can  also look at thrift stores or garage sales. You can frequently purchase cool vintage stuff that adds character to your wedding décor at little cost. For those of you who are creative, you can make some of your decorations.  Some  simple DIY elements, such as making your own table runners or centerpieces can cut costs and add a personal touch. You might use fabric scraps to make (or upcycle) a patchwork table  runner, or pour sand and candles in jars  for a beautiful centerpiece. Social media, Pinterest and Instagram in  particular, are also awesome sources for inspiration when it comes to ideas for budget  decorations. Lots of couples also include their DIY projects and where they sourced their supplies. And finally, you probably should rely on friends and relatives for assistance. They may have decor from their own weddings that you  could borrow or purchase inexpensively. So, with a bit of imagination and some leg work you can pick up beautiful  table decorations without breaking the  bank.

Planning eco friendly wedding table decorations is a brilliant idea for several reasons. For starters, when you choose decorations  that are nice to the Earth, you’re saving on waste. A lot of the traditional decorations are made out of plastic or other things that harm our planet. Instead, environment-friendly alternatives can be fashioned from things like recycled paper,  bamboo or even flowers that can be planted afterward. What this also means:  After the  wedding, your decorations either can  be reused or they’ll naturally disintegrate, and there won’t be disgusting litter left in your wake.
